What are the responsibilities and job description for the Program Director (Residential Substance Use Treatment Center) position at The Manor?
POSITION TITLE: Program Director
REPORTS TO: Executive Clinical Director
JOB TYPE: Full Time
The Manor provides personalized, trauma-focused residential treatment for substance use disorders and co-occurring mental health concerns. Nestled in Wisconsin's Kettle Moraine Forest, clients live and receive treatment within a comfortable and confidential setting. As an independently owned facility, The Manor prioritizes clients' clinical needs, offering holistic, personalized treatment plans and private suites—all designed to foster respect, healing, and lasting recovery. The Manor focuses on treating underlying trauma to help individuals gain the skills they need to move forward and heal.
PRIMARY DUTY
This role involves overseeing and supporting clinical operations while ensuring effective and comprehensive client care. The ideal candidate will bring a clinical understanding and background along with an administrative skillset. The Program Director is responsible for ensuring that the highest quality of care is consistently delivered to all clients. They will provide supervision and offer guidance and support to all staff. An ideal candidate is skilled in systems-level operations with an interest in clinical touchpoints and tracking the client experience. Although the role is primarily administrative, an ideal candidate will have an understanding of trauma and its connection to substance use disorders, be clinically minded, and will ensure that programming decisions reinforce the importance of creating a supportive and clinically sensitive treatment environment.
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S include the following. Other duties may be assigned.
- Manage daily clinical operations, ensuring smooth program delivery and client engagement.
- Address client and staff concerns.
- Lead group therapy sessions (no individual caseload).
- Develop and improve clinical systems and processes.
- Train and support staff, working with HR for onboarding and ongoing education.
- Review client records, enforce compliance, and implement necessary improvements.
- Handle staff scheduling, including on-call and weekend duties as needed.
- Ensure compliance with company policies and legal regulations.
- Perform additional duties as required.
SUPERVISORY REQUIREMENTS of this position are generally as follows:
- Provide management, guidance, and training of therapists, counselors, and coaches as needed to ensure effective program management.
- Direct involvement in hiring, performance evaluations, and disciplinary actions for relevant staff members.
EDUCATION, EXPERIENCE, and OTHER REQUIREMENTS an equivalent combination of education, training and experience will be considered.
- Master’s degree in social work or counseling required.
- Licensure in Wisconsin preferred but not required (LPC or LCSW).
- Preferred four years in a related field, preferably experience and/or training with trauma and substance use disorders.
- Prior experience managing staff and working in a substance abuse/or 12 step program setting strongly preferred.
